The travel app has announced its latest awards.

Erindale Cakery Bakery was revealed as the ACT winner of the best finger bun. The national award went to the Humble Bakery in Sydney. And who makes the best sausage roll in the ACT? That honour went to Three Mills Bakery in Fyshwick.

And while the ACT didn't win any of the national awards, the finalists can be proud of winning each of their categories. Some of the ACT winners.
